Arts program
St John
of God Murdoch Hospital has an art collection of more thans 100
artworks by significant Western Australian artists that allows the
hospital to not only offer therapeutic benefits, but also provides
a strong educational focus and stimulating environment for staff,
doctors, patients and visitors.
Murdoch is committed to building an arts
program that is a flagship for health, healing and the arts. While
excellence in medical care and technology are vital parts of the
healing process, our values-based care has a firm foundation in the
belief and practice of holistic health care, of which the arts is
essential.
It was primarily through staff and patient
interaction that the greatest benefits for art in a hospital
environment are highlighted.
Staff are often seen transporting patients
through the Linking
Gallery, talking about the artworks. These conversations
contribute toward a greater appreciation and understanding of
the arts and its therapeutic benefits.
